This article describes the Azure SQL restore workflow.
Step | Description | Cloud |
Step 1 | The Scheduler triggers the restore job per the backup policy schedule. | Druva AWS Cloud |
Step 2 | The restore job requests a VM from VM orchestration. | Druva AWS Cloud |
Step 3 | Job orchestration requests the creation of a VM in the customer’s Azure Environment. | Customer’s Azure Cloud |
Step 4 | Data is downloaded from the Storage service and transferred to the transient Blob storage. | Druva AWS Cloud |
Step 5 | An import request is sent to the Druva's Quantum Bridge. | Customer’s Azure Cloud |
Step 6 | Data is read from the transient Blob storage and moved to the customer Azure VM. | Customer’s Azure Cloud |
Step 7 | Data is restored to the Azure SQL resources and CDC is replayed. | Customer’s Azure Cloud |
Step 8 | A request is sent to delete the Druva's Quantum Bridge. | Customer’s Azure Cloud |
